Factors Influencing Freight Rates in Mississippi

Several factors affect freight rates in Mississippi, including distance, cargo type, weight, and the urgency of delivery. Additionally, market demand, fuel prices, and seasonal fluctuations can cause rates to vary. Understanding these elements helps businesses plan better and negotiate effectively.

How to Find the Best Freight Deals

  • Compare Multiple Carriers: Obtain quotes from several freight companies to identify competitive rates.
  • Negotiate Terms: Use your shipping volume as leverage to negotiate discounts or better terms.
  • Consolidate Shipments: Combine smaller shipments to reduce costs per unit.
  • Plan Ahead: Book freight services in advance to avoid premium charges during peak times.
  • Leverage Technology: Use freight comparison platforms and logistics software to find optimal routes and prices.

Mississippi offers various freight options suitable for different needs:

  • Truck Freight: The most common method for short and medium distances, offering flexibility and speed.
  • Rail Freight: Cost-effective for large volumes over longer distances, especially for bulk commodities.
  • Water Freight: Ideal for shipping goods via Mississippi River and Gulf of Mexico routes.
  • Air Freight: Suitable for urgent shipments, though more expensive.

Additional Tips for Saving on Freight Costs

To maximize savings, consider the following tips:

  • Build Strong Relationships: Develop good rapport with your freight providers for better negotiation power.
  • Monitor Market Trends: Stay informed about fuel prices and economic factors affecting freight rates.
  • Optimize Packaging: Use efficient packaging to reduce weight and dimensions, lowering costs.
  • Implement Freight Audit Systems: Regularly review freight bills to identify errors and overcharges.
